- #include <config.h>
- #include <stdio.h>
- #include <unistd.h>
- #include <errno.h>
- #include <starpu.h>
- #include <stdlib.h>
- #include "../helper.h"
- #include <common/thread.h>
- #define NITERS 1000000
- #define NTASKS 128
- #ifdef STARPU_USE_CUDA
- extern void long_kernel_cuda(unsigned long niters);
- void codelet_long_kernel(STARPU_ATTRIBUTE_UNUSED void *descr[], STARPU_ATTRIBUTE_UNUSED void *_args)
- {
- long_kernel_cuda(NITERS);
- }
- static struct starpu_perfmodel model =
- {
- .type = STARPU_HISTORY_BASED,
- .symbol = "long_kernel",
- };
- static struct starpu_codelet cl =
- {
- .cuda_funcs = {codelet_long_kernel, NULL},
- .cuda_flags = {STARPU_CUDA_ASYNC},
- .nbuffers = 0,
- .model = &model
- };
- #endif
- int main(int argc, char **argv)
- {
- #ifndef STARPU_USE_CUDA
- return STARPU_TEST_SKIPPED;
- #else
- int ret = starpu_initialize(NULL, &argc, &argv);
- if (ret == -ENODEV) return STARPU_TEST_SKIPPED;
- STARPU_CHECK_RETURN_VALUE(ret, "starpu_init");
- if (starpu_cuda_worker_get_count() == 0)
- {
- starpu_shutdown();
- return STARPU_TEST_SKIPPED;
- }
- unsigned iter;
- for (iter = 0; iter < NTASKS; iter++)
- {
- struct starpu_task *task = starpu_task_create();
- task->cl = &cl;
- ret = starpu_task_submit(task);
- if (ret == -ENODEV) goto enodev;
- STARPU_CHECK_RETURN_VALUE(ret, "starpu_task_submit");
- }
- starpu_shutdown();
- STARPU_RETURN(EXIT_SUCCESS);
- enodev:
- fprintf(stderr, "WARNING: No one can execute this task\n");
- /* yes, we do not perform the computation but we did detect that no one
- * could perform the kernel, so this is not an error from StarPU */
- starpu_shutdown();
- STARPU_RETURN(STARPU_TEST_SKIPPED);
- #endif
- }
